Microsoft® Office Excel® 2007: Level 3
Course length: 1.0 day(s)Certification: Microsoft Certified Application Specialist: Microsoft Office Excel 2007
Upon successful completion of this course, students will be able to:
- increase productivity and improve efficiency by streamlining your workflow.
- collaborate with others using workbooks.
- audit worksheets.
- analyze data.
- work with multiple workbooks.
- import and export data.
- use Excel with the web.
- structure workbooks with XML.
